NYPD cops shot and killed a domestic violence suspect who fired at them on a Brooklyn street Thursday night, police said. The fatal shooting unfolded after a police sergeant and another cop on patrol heard gunshots ring out while they in the area of West 36th Street and Mermaid Avenue in Coney Island around 10:15 p.m., the NYPD said. As the two cops raced to the scene, they were approached by two women who told them a man was firing a gun at that intersection, NYPDs Chief of Patrol Jeffrey Maddrey told reporters at a press conference early Friday morning.
